JOB SUMMARY

Responsible for performing initial appraisal of potential borrowers by thoroughly examining their applications; assessing the credit standings of applicants through background research; and interviewing applicants to evaluate their eligibility for loan or mortgage.

Essential Functions
  • Identify customer needs, explore all options, and suggest different types of loans. Review files for completeness and accuracy.
  • Verify accuracy of system input.
  • Analyze file for program applicability.
  • Review necessary documentation, such as income and asset documentation, credit report, verifications, appraisal report, preliminary title report, etc.
  • Follow up with clients to request additional documents as needed or to clarify important points.
  • Provide status updates to loan officers, borrowers, and agents.
  • Remain up to speed regarding lending and other financial services.
  • Coordinate all aspects of submission to underwriting, documentation requests and satisfaction of closing/funding conditions. Coordinate closings as needed.
  • Submit files in a timely manner in accordance with company standards.
  • Review pre-audit HUD-1 to ensure accuracy. Work with loan officer and title companies to resolve any discrepancies prior to closing.
  • Prioritize workflow to ensure time sensitive files are handled in proper order.
  • Assure compliance with all regulatory and governmental standards, guidelines, rules and regulations with all regulatory authorities, federal or state ordinances and administrative regulations and statues.
  • Forge trust relationship and enhance customer dedication.
  • Ensures confidentiality of bank and customer information.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.
Preferred Skills
  • Preferably 5 years or more processing conventional, VA and FHA loans.
  • Encompass experience preferred.
Requirements
  • Post TRID knowledge required.
  • Comprehension of direct/indirect lending procedures.
  • In-depth understanding of relevant rules and regulations.
  • Strong organization skills and detail oriented.
  • Excellent communication and sales skills.
